> On 12/15/2010 08:05 AM, Hao, Xudong wrote:
> > Hi, all,
> > This is KVM test result against kvm.git d335b156f9fafd177d0606cf845d9a2df2dc5431, and qemu-kvm.git cb1983b8809d0e06a97384a40bad1194a32fc814.
> >
> > Currently qemu-kvm build fail on RHEL5 with a undeclared "PCI_PM_CTRL_NO_SOFT_RST" error. I saw there already were fix patch in mail list.
> > There are 2 bugs got fixed.
> >
> > Fixed issues:
> > 1. Guest qemu processor will be defunct process by be killed
> > https://bugzilla.kernel.org/show_bug.cgi?id=23612
> 
> Good to see it was indeed fixed by -rc5.
> 
> > 2. [SR] qemu return form "migrate " command spend long time
> > https://sourceforge.net/tracker/?func=detail&aid=2942079&group_id=180599&atid=893831
> >
> 
> Juan, Luiz, any idea what fixed this?  I saw it too.

The funny thing is that you've fixed it yourself:  :)

commit 5e77aaa0d7d2f4ceaa4fcaf50f3a26d5150f34a6
Author: Avi Kivity <avi@redhat.com>
Date:   Wed Jul 7 19:44:22 2010 +0300

    QEMUFileBuffered: indicate that we're ready when the underlying file is ready

> 
> 
> Xudong, please open qemu bugs on launchpad (https://launchpad.net/qemu), 
> not on sourceforge.  Kernel bugs go to the kernel bugzilla as usual.  
> We'll retire the sourceforge bug tracker.
